frensham pond sailability

The charity supports people with disabilities. Frensham Pond Sailability is a registered charity whose purpose is amateur sport. It delivers its work by providing buildings, facilities, or open space. The charity is based in Farnham and operates in Hampshire and Surrey.

Activities & Mission

Frensham Pond Sailability is a registered charity whose objects are the provision and maintenance of sailing facilities and the promotion of sailing for recreation or other leisure activities (including without limitation recreational and competitive sailing) for disabled people with the object of improving their quality and conditions of life.
